TestBike logo

Ambassador mapping tls. (Optional) Create and Upload a values file with TLS certificate and Priv...

Ambassador mapping tls. (Optional) Create and Upload a values file with TLS certificate and Private key Starting with version 3. In Ambassador Edge Stack, the simplest Feb 26, 2026 · Learn how to expose ArgoCD through Ambassador/Emissary-Ingress with proper gRPC routing, TLS termination, and authentication filters. Introduction Ambassador is an API Gateway for cloud-native applications that routes traffic between heterogeneous services and maintains decentralized workflows. 50 API gateway adds support for Server Name Indication (SNI), a much-requested feature from the community that allows the configuration of multiple TLS certificates to served from a single ingress IP address. Jul 4, 2024 · Advanced Mapping configuration Emissary is designed so that the author of a given Kubernetes service can easily and flexibly configure how traffic gets routed to the service. Apr 13, 2021 · The Ambassador Edge Stack has simple and easy built-in support for automatically using ACME to create and renew TLS certificates; configured by the Host resource. Know about Ambassador Edge Stack resource usage in your DOKS cluster (Performance Considerations guide). com will be routed as above; HTTP to foo. Ambassador Mapping s are based on URL prefixes; for gRPC, the URL prefix is the full service name, including the package path. In order to configure a custom TLS certificate and private key Feb 1, 2024 · In this tutorial, you will learn how to use the Ambassador Edge Stack ingress (AES for short). For Gravitee is an open-source, event-native API management platform that you can use throughout the entire API lifecycle to design, deploy, manage, and secure both synchronous and asynchronous APIs. Overview 2. . Table of contents Prerequisites Step 1 - Installing the Ambassador Edge Stack Jul 16, 2021 · How can I use Ambassador Emissary -ingress for TLS? Ask Question Asked 4 years, 7 months ago Modified 4 years, 7 months ago Sep 9, 2024 · Emissary’s robust TLS support exposes configuration options for different TLS use cases including: Simultaneously Routing HTTP and HTTPS HTTP -> HTTPS Redirection Mutual TLS Server Name Indication (SNI) TLS Origination Host As explained in the Host reference, a Host represents a domain in Emissary and defines how TLS is managed on that domain. The core abstraction used to support service authors is a mapping, which maps a target backend service to a given host or prefix. Create and configure Ambassador Edge Stack host Mappings. Ambassador natively supports Linkerd2 for service discovery and end-to-end TLS (including mTLS between services). 7 of the SCALE platform, a default TLS certificate and private key will be configured into the Ambassador mapping by the platform. Create and configure the Ambassador Edge Stack domain and hosts. com will be redirected to HTTPS; HTTP or HTTPS to other hostnames will be rejected; and the Certain aspects of mappings can be set system-wide using the defaults element of the ambassador Module: see using defaults for more information. For Layer 7 protocols such as HTTP, gRPC, or WebSockets, the Mapping resource is used. In this article I will show you how to install the Ambassador Gateway and other components to be For demonstration purposes, here's a possible way of combining a Listener, a Host, and both Mapping s above that is complete and functional: it will accept HTTP or HTTPS on port 8443; p r o d u c t N a m e is terminating TLS; HTTPS to foo. Then, you’re going to discover how to have TLS certificates automatically deployed and configured for your hosts, and route traffic to your backend applications. This certificate and private key combination can be superceded by a custom pair as an option. Ambassador Edge Stack is designed so that the author of a given Kubernetes service can easily and flexibly configure how traffic gets routed to the service. example. For TCP, the Jun 24, 2020 · Securing Kubernetes Ingress with Ambassador and Let's Encrypt In addition to routing the incoming requests or exposing service API's through a single endpoint, the ingress gateways does other tasks, such as rate limiting, SSL termination, load balancing, authentication, circuit breaking and more. For more information, see the documentation on TCP. Automatically configure TLS certificates for your Hosts, thus having TLS termination. Oct 23, 2019 · The author selected the Free and Open Source Fund to receive a donation as part of the Write for DOnations program. It acts as a single entry point and supports tasks like service discovery, configuration management, routing rules Jan 29, 2019 · The open source Ambassador 0. Mar 8, 2019 · Ambassador can also terminate TLS-encrypted TCP connections, and optionally originate encrypted TLS to the upstream service. Oct 16, 2019 · Linkerd2 is a zero-config and ultra-lightweight service mesh. The Mapping element will look first in the httpmapping default class. ただ、Ambassadorの古いバージョンでは証明書の更新を自動で更新を行わないた、め起動して1年が経つと証明書の有効期限が切れてしまい、上記のエラーが発生します。 Mar 1, 2018 · Other useful annotations include method, which lets you define the HTTP method for mapping; grpc, for gRPC-based services; and tls which tells Ambassador to contact the service over TLS. For Hello World, in its proto definition file, we see May 23, 2019 · How to leverage Ambassador to secure apps running in your Kubernetes clusters with TLS certificates for free. udk vhjcy uka vmsb vdtsazy xoneuq yvbq lfna iuec ancgg